Aberdour Castle

Built by the Douglas family, the 13th century fortified residence was extended in the 15th, 16th & 17th centuries. The finished result provided accommodation with a gallery and fine painted ceiling. Also delightful walled garden with beehive-shaped doocot.
Access is limited to part of the ground floor which includes a tearoom, the walled garden and the upper terrace to the south of the castle. Upper floors and terraces are not suitable for visitors using wheelchairs or with limited mobility as access is by turnpike stairs.
Gravel paths to the gardens/grounds can be difficult for visitors using wheelchairs, however access is possible with assistance and for more mobile visitors. Visitors to the walled garden can enjoy its scented flowers.
Toilets: STB Category 3 disabled toilet facilities are available through the shop.
